Notifications on Your Phone

New orders and waiter calls reach the right person, even with the panel closed

Open the 🔔 Notifications tab. Every role has it, because everyone needs to hear something different.

New orders and waiter calls arrive as a notification on this device, even when the panel is closed.

This matters most in a venue where nobody is standing in front of a screen: a small kitchen, a terrace, a shop where you are the only person working.

Notifications belong to a device, not to an account. Every phone, every tablet, every till is switched on separately, where it stands.

  1. Sign in on the device that should ring
  2. Open 🔔 Notifications
  3. Press “Turn notifications on”
  4. Choose Allow when the browser asks

The card then reads “On for this device” and shows how many devices are registered.

The card “What arrives on this device” tells each person what they will get, based on their role:

Role Receives
Owner / Manager Everything: new orders, food ready, waiter calls
Kitchen New orders
Service Food ready and waiter calls
Cashier Nothing automatic, test notifications only

The notifications themselves are short and say what to do:

Notification Text
New order “Table 7, 3 items”
Waiter called “Table 7 needs help”
Order ready “Table 7, ready to serve”

12.3 Testing, and what to do when nothing arrives

Press “Send a test notification”. The device shows “Notifications are working.” within a few seconds. Do this once per device, right after switching on.

What the card says What to do
“Off for this device” Press “Turn notifications on”
“Connection expired, nothing arrives any more” Press “Reconnect”
“The browser refused permission.” Allow notifications for this site in the browser settings, then switch on again
“This browser cannot show notifications.” An old browser, or an iPhone where the panel is not on the Home Screen (see 12.1)
“Notifications are not set up on this server.” Contact miraTEQ
